Carport power washing involves using high-pressure water and specialized cleaning solutions to remove dirt, grime, mold, algae, and other buildup from the surfaces of a carport. This service effectively restores the appearance of the structure, making it look cleaner and more inviting. Power washing can also help prepare the surface for painting or sealing, ensuring that any new coatings adhere properly. It’s a thorough cleaning method that reaches into crevices and hard-to-reach areas, providing a comprehensive refresh for your carport.

This service helps address common problems such as slippery moss, stubborn stains, and mold growth that can develop over time due to exposure to the elements. These issues not only diminish curb appeal but can also cause surfaces to become unsafe or deteriorate faster. Regular power washing can extend the lifespan of the materials used in a carport, prevent decay, and maintain the structural integrity of the property. Homeowners often turn to power washing when they notice surfaces looking dull, stained, or covered in algae, especially after seasons with heavy rainfall or humidity.

The overview below groups typical Carport Power Washing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Jose,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ine carport power washing in San Jose range from $250 to $600. Many standard jobs fall within this range, covering cleaning of dirt, mold, and mildew on smaller structures.

Mid-Size Projects - Larger carports or those requiring more intensive cleaning may c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ects often involve more extensive surface area or stubborn stains but remain common for local service providers.

Extensive or Commercial Jobs - Complex or heavily soiled carports can reach $1,200 to $2,500, especially for multiple structures or commercial properties. Fewer projects push into this higher range, typically for larger or more challenging jobs.

Full Replacement or Major Restoration - Complete replacement of a carport’s surface can exceed $5,000, though this is less common. Most local pros focus on cleaning and maintenance, with full rebuilds being a specialized, higher-cost service.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is carport power washing? Carport power washing involves using high-pressure water to remove dirt, mold, and grime from the surfaces of a carport, helping to restore its appearance and prevent damage.

Are there different types of power washing services for carports? Yes, service providers may offer various methods such as pressure washing or soft washing, depending on the material of the carport and the level of cleaning needed.

How can local contractors ensure safe cleaning of my carport? Professional contractors typically assess the surface material and use appropriate pressure levels and cleaning solutions to ensure effective cleaning without causing damage.

What surfaces can be cleaned with carport power washing? Power washing can be effective on concrete, wood, metal, and other common carport materials, helping to remove stains, moss, and debris.
